About Putnam County

Putnam County is a county located in the U.S. state of Indiana. As of the 2020 United States census, the population was 36,726. The county seat is Greencastle. The county was named for Israel Putnam, a hero in the French and Indian War and a general in the American Revolutionary War. The county was created in 1821 and organized in April 1822.

Swung Right in 2024

Putnam County shifted 1.8 points toward Republicans compared to 2020. Voter turnout increased by 0.8%.
